WebOct 7, 2024 · Data Deletion on a Hard Drive. A traditional hard drive stores files in physical locations on a magnetic platter. The operating system indexes the file locations in a file system and accesses the data using a mechanical arm. Heck, hard drives are typically only reliable for 3-5 years and then become increasingly prone to failures. Online backup company BackBlaze analyzed its 25,000 hard drives and found that there was a 20% failure rate after four years of heavy use.
